What can be reviewed before selecting a roller-bearing route

A useful review covers more than the headline family name. Roller-bearing decisions often depend on how the load enters the assembly, how the bearing is mounted, and what the service environment will do over time.

  • Family selection across taper, cylindrical, spherical, and related roller-bearing lines.
  • Checking cup-and-cone, ring, housing, and shaft details that affect fit and service behavior.
  • Reviewing lubrication, contamination, endplay, or misalignment conditions before the quote is finalized.
  • Preparing repeat-order controls so approved versions are easier to reorder with fewer clarifying emails.

Questions procurement teams raise on roller-bearing RFQs

What should a buyer send before requesting a roller-bearing quote?

Share the current part reference or dimensions, quantity, operating load, speed, lubrication details, and any housing or shaft notes. Those facts usually determine whether the initial family choice is even correct.

When do roller-bearing enquiries need more application review?

Extra review is helpful when the bearing carries shock, runs hot, sits in a contaminated environment, or depends on a correct setting or mounting method to survive.

Can one source support taper, cylindrical, and spherical requirements on the same account?

Yes, if the product families are reviewed against the real load case and the approved versions are recorded clearly for future purchasing.

Why can a lower quote become the more expensive roller-bearing decision?

A lower number can still lead to installation trouble, premature wear, repeat labor, or supply confusion if the mechanical route was not reviewed carefully.

How should buyers choose among taper, cylindrical, and spherical options?

Start with load direction, misalignment, speed, mounting layout, and maintenance access. The correct family usually follows from those facts.
